12–507.24. Military Personnel Automobile Tax Exemptions. A. Description: Tax exemption forms showing vehicles owned by military personnel who are stationed in the county, but are legal residents of other states and are subject to taxes in the state of legal residence. Information includes owners name, address, vehicle year, make, model, VIN number, date, social security number, signature of owner, signature of commanding officer. B. Retention: 3 years, then destroy. HISTORY: Added by State Register Volume 26, Issue No. 4, eff April 26, 2002.
